/**
* NNStorageDirectoryRetentionManager manages the primary/standby backups created on startup.
* On primary format/standby startup, it copies all its own storage directories aside,
* marking them with a time stamp (e.g., clustername:2012-10-11-06:42:03.149).
*
* The policy is governed by two parameters:
*
* A) standby.image.days.tokeep - minimum days to keep backups
* B) standby.image.copies.tokeep - minimum copies of backup to keep.
*
* -------
* If A > 0, at startup, the journal/fsimage manager will prune all backups older than A,
* providing that it retains at least B copies (together with the current one).
* If more copies than B are left, the standby will abort startup.
*
* If A == 0, the journal/fsimage manager will keep B copies (together with the current one.
* In this case, the startup would never fail, as the standby will remove the
* oldest copies.
*
* Special case: If both A and B are 0, the journal/fsimage manager does not delete any backups.
*/
